HUNTINGTON BEACH, Calif. — The WateReuse Association announced registration is now available for the 19th Annual Water Reuse & Desalination Research Conference, according to a press release.

The conference will take place May 4-5 in Huntington Beach, California, and will feature the latest research addressing social, scientific and economic barriers to widespread water reuse and desalination, stated the release.

The program for the event will cover research related to potable reuse, pathogens and disinfection, reuse planning and case studies, treatment technologies, desalination and energy, reported the release.

Those planning to attend can register by March 20 to receive an early bird discount, and a special rate is available at the Waterfront Beach Resort until April 13, noted the release.
